linux安装速度太慢
时间: 2025-04-29 16:11:27 浏览: 11
### 提升Linux系统安装速度的方法
#### 减少不必要的软件包安装
在安装过程中可以选择最小化安装选项,只安装必要的核心组件。这可以显著缩短安装时间并减少磁盘占用空间[^1]。
对于基于Debian的发行版(如Ubuntu),可以通过指定`--no-install-recommends`参数来实现这一点:
```bash
sudo apt-get install --no-install-recommends package_name
```
而对于基于RPM的发行版(如Fedora、CentOS),则可以在yum命令后面加上`--setopt=install_weak_deps=False`选项:
```bash
sudo yum install --setopt=install_weak_deps=False package_name
```
#### 使用快速镜像源
选择一个距离较近且稳定的官方或第三方仓库镜像能够有效提升下载速度。许多Linux发行版允许用户更改默认APT/YUM库地址为国内高校或其他机构提供的加速站点[^2]。
例如,在Ubuntu中编辑 `/etc/apt/sources.list` 文件中的URL链接指向阿里云等提供更快访问速度的服务商;而在Red Hat系操作系统里则是修改对应的`.repo`文件内的baseurl字段值。
#### 并行处理任务
当网络带宽充足时,可利用多线程工具如`axel` 或者 `aria2` 来并发获取多个资源片段从而加快整个过程:
- 安装 axel 工具:
```bash
sudo apt install axel # Debian-based systems
sudo yum install axel # RPM-based distributions
```
- 利用 axel 下载大文件 (以Nginx为例):
```bash
axel -n 10 -o /usr/local/ http://nginx.org/download/nginx-1.24.0.tar.gz
```
这里 `-n` 参数指定了最大连接数为10,可以根据实际需求调整此数值大小[^3]。
#### 预先准备依赖项
提前准备好所需的依赖关系列表,并一次性批量解决这些依赖问题有助于避免反复查询和解析的过程浪费过多的时间成本。
---
阅读全文